#google-sheets #google-sheets-formula
#google-sheets #google-sheets-формула
Вопрос:
ПРИМЕР:
У меня есть один столбец с названием песни (только текст) [СТОЛБЕЦ A].
У меня есть еще один столбец со ссылкой на эту песню где-то еще в Интернете [СТОЛБЕЦ B].
Я хочу создать новый столбец [столбец C] и вставить формулу во вторую строку (потому что 1-я строка — это имя / заголовок столбца), которая будет ссылаться на данные в обоих столбцах A и B и объединять их, чтобы результат отображался в виде интерактивной ссылки для каждого столбца.каждой строки в столбце C.
Столбцы A и B могут быть скрыты, поэтому для каждой строки отображается только столбец C с результатом
Я делаю нечто подобное для другого столбца, который преобразует МИЛЛИСЕКУНДЫ из одного столбца в СЕКУНДЫ, используя приведенную ниже формулу, которая помещается во вторую строку пустого столбца (за исключением строки 1, которая является заголовком / именем столбца), где результат будет отображаться в каждой строке этого столбца. Все ячейки в каждой строке этого столбца под формулой ДОЛЖНЫ быть пустыми, чтобы результат отображался.
=ArrayFormula(if(M2: M=»»,,M2:M / 3600000 / 24))
…где M представляет столбец с данными за МИЛЛИСЕКУНДЫ, а 2 представляет 2-ю строку, где помещается формула, при этом все строки под ней пустые, чтобы результат можно было поместить туда…
Если вы все еще не уверены, что я пытаюсь объяснить, возможно, если вы точно знаете, что я делаю, вы поймете. Вот текстовый файл, который объясняет это в мельчайших подробностях:
http://noyou.net/spotify/Spotify_and_Google_Sheets.txt
Я не уверен, как создать формулу, чтобы делать то, что я хочу, как объяснено выше, чтобы объединить текстовый элемент из одного столбца с URL-адресом из другого столбца с результатом, показанным (с помощью формулы) в каждой строке нового пустого столбца.
Я знаю, как делать это по одной строке за раз, но я хочу, чтобы формула выполняла это для всех строк и помещала результат автоматически.
С этим работает по одной строке за раз:
= гиперссылка (H2, N2), где H = столбец url, N = столбец названия песни, а номер — для строки. Но я не хочу добавлять одну и ту же формулу к каждой строке, увеличивая число в формуле для каждой строки.
Спасибо!
Ответ №1:
=ArrayFormula(IF(A2:A="",,HYPERLINK(B2:B,A2:A)))